What You Will DoIn this role you will be the connection to our customers by providing clinical knowledge of Amgen products to medical professionals and helping them navigate the payer environment. The Senior Specialty Representative acts as the primary customer contact and is responsible for implementing marketing strategy and promoting Amgen products as led by the District Manager.
- Provide current and comprehensive knowledge of Amgen's products and communicate clinical benefits to medical professionals to drive appropriate utilization.
- Lead territory sales by delivering branded messages, conducting planned programs, scheduling and following up with medical educational programs, and achieving or exceeding sales targets through in-person and virtual engagement.
- Develop relationships to service and manage accounts, tailoring discussions to customer needs, ensuring product access, resolving reimbursement issues, and maintaining contracts.
- Provide feedback on marketing strategy, analyze sales activities and territory performance, and develop territory plans with the District Manager.

We are all different, yet we all contribute to serving patients. The sales professional we seek is motivated and qualified with the following:
Basic Qualifications- Bachelor's degree and 3 years of sales experience and/or clinical experience in healthcare/scientific field that is not sales related
- OR
- Associate degree and 6 years of sales experience and/or clinical experience in healthcare/scientific field that is not sales related
- OR
- High school diploma/GED and 8 years of sales experience and/or clinical experience in healthcare/scientific field that is not sales related
- More than 3 years of sales, marketing and/or clinical experience within pharmaceutical, biotech, diagnostics, healthcare insurance, pharmacy services, medical devices, or related industries
- Product or hospital sales experience in oncology, cardiology, inflammation, nephrology, dermatology, rheumatology, neurology, endocrinology, hepatology, gastroenterology, bone health, respiratory, hematology, or infectious diseases
- Advanced influencing and relationship-building skills focused on sales outcomes
- Local market knowledge and a Bachelor’s degree in Life Sciences or Business Administration

The expected annual salary range for this role in the U.S. (excluding Puerto Rico) is $121,379 - $149,742. Actual salary will vary based on factors such as skills, experience, and qualifications.
